Nepal Adventure Day Trip

8:00AM: Kathmandu Durbar Square

Start your day exploring the heart of Kathmandu at Durbar Square. This UNESCO World Heritage Site is a complex of palaces, courtyards, and temples dating back to the 12th century. Marvel at the impressive architecture, intricate wood carvings, and ancient relics. Don't miss the famous Kumari House, home to the living goddess.

10:00AM: Swayambhunath Stupa

Make your way to Swayambhunath, also known as the Monkey Temple. Situated on a hilltop, this iconic stupa offers panoramic views of Kathmandu Valley. Climb the 365 steps to reach the main stupa adorned with prayer flags and colorful prayer wheels. Be sure to interact with the resident monkeys who call this temple their home.

12:00PM: Lunch at Boudhanath

Head to Boudhanath, one of the largest Buddhist stupas in the world. This sacred site attracts pilgrims and visitors alike. Explore the surrounding monasteries, spin the prayer wheels, and soak in the peaceful atmosphere. Enjoy a delicious traditional Nepali lunch at one of the local restaurants nearby.

2:00PM: Pashupatinath Temple

Visit Pashupatinath, the most sacred Hindu temple in Nepal. Located on the banks of the Bagmati River, this temple complex is dedicated to Lord Shiva. Witness the rituals and ceremonies performed by Sadhus (holy men) and observe the open-air cremation ghats. Respect the religious customs and traditions while exploring this significant religious site.

4:00PM: Patan Durbar Square

End your day at Patan Durbar Square, another UNESCO World Heritage Site. This ancient royal palace complex is known for its exquisite Newari architecture. Admire the intricate stone carvings, pagoda-style temples, and the famous Krishna Mandir. Take a leisurely stroll through the narrow lanes of Patan and explore the vibrant arts and crafts scene.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path attractions, head to Nagarkot for breathtaking sunrise views of the Himalayas. Enjoy a peaceful hike in the Shivapuri Nagarjun National Park, just a short distance from Kathmandu. Indulge in a traditional Nepali meal at a local homestay to experience the warm hospitality and authentic flavors of the region. Don't miss out on exploring the bustling streets of Thamel, Kathmandu's tourist hub, for souvenir shopping and vibrant nightlife.
